Output 180334554427d24e60db1c75d2dcbbf3e7291d2149ddf2f0dba384f330645ed2:13

value
180195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4d83980fd1f723c442a1575ddb424aaa71f3dc OP_EQUAL
address
3PWLHAJ7GVb5dkNoqyb1Nb4fPhmpPGnfsn
transaction
180334554427d24e60db1c75d2dcbbf3e7291d2149ddf2f0dba384f330645ed2
confirmations
214875
spent
true